How is the weather in Saugatuck Township?
Saugatuck Township experiences cold winters around 21–33°F (-6–0°C), with snow possible, and warm summers near 62–82°F (17–28°C). Spring and autumn bring moderate temperatures and occasional rain showers.

What is Saugatuck Township known for?
Saugatuck Township is known for scenic Lake Michigan dunes, vibrant arts communities, and historic waterfront areas. Locally owned shops, galleries, and easy access to outdoor recreation attract visitors year-round.
